What is a Virtual Attacker for Hire?
A virtual enemy for Hire Hacker For Cybersecurity is a cybersecurity expert authorized by an organization to imitate real-world cyberattacks against its infrastructure. Unlike malicious "black hat" hackers who look for to take information or cause interruption for personal gain, these specialists operate under strict legal frameworks and "rules of engagement."

Their main objective is to recognize security weaknesses before a criminal does. By mimicking the methods, methods, and treatments (TTPs) of actual hazard actors, they supply organizations with a practical view of their security posture.
The Spectrum of Offensive Security
Offensive security is not a one-size-fits-all service. It ranges from automated scans to extremely complicated, multi-month simulations.

Employing an assailant follows a structured procedure to ensure that the testing is safe, legal, and thorough. A typical engagement follows these five stages:
1. Scoping and Rules of Engagement
Before a single package is sent out, the company and the virtual aggressor need to agree on the limits. This consists of defining which IP addresses are "in-scope," what time of day screening can happen, and what methods are forbidden (e.g., damaging malware that might crash production servers).
2. Reconnaissance (Information Gathering)
The assaulter begins by collecting as much info as possible about the target. This includes "Passive Recon" (browsing public records, LinkedIn, and WHOIS information) and "Active Recon" (port scanning and service identification).
3. Vulnerability Analysis
Using the data gathered, the opponent searches for entry points. This might be an unpatched legacy server, a misconfigured cloud storage pail, or a weak password policy.
4. Exploitation
This is where the "attack" takes place. The expert attempts to access to the system. When within, they may attempt "Lateral Movement"-- moving from one computer to another-- to see if they can reach high-value targets like the domain controller or the client database.
5. Reporting and Remediation
The most vital stage is the shipment of the findings. A virtual enemy provides a comprehensive report that consists of:
A summary for executives.Technical information of the vulnerabilities found.Evidence of exploitation (screenshots).Step-by-step remediation suggestions to fix the holes.Comparing the "Before and After"

Is it legal to hire somebody to attack my business?
Yes, offered there is a written agreement and clear permission. This is called "Ethical Hacking." Without a contract, the very same actions might be thought about an infraction of the Computer Fraud and Abuse Act (CFAA) or comparable international laws.
2. What is the distinction in between a "White Hat" and a "Black Hat"?
A White Hat is an ethical Affordable Hacker For Hire who has approval to evaluate a system and utilizes their skills to enhance security. A Black Hat is a crook who hacks for personal gain, spite, or political reasons without permission.
3. Will the virtual opponent see my company's delicate information?
In a lot of cases, yes. To prove a vulnerability exists, they might need to access a database or file. Nevertheless, ethical opponents are bound by Non-Disclosure Agreements (NDAs) and professional principles to manage this information firmly and erase any copies after the engagement.
4. Can an offending security test crash my systems?
While there is constantly a small danger when connecting with systems, professional aggressors utilize "non-destructive" methods. They often focus on stability over deep exploitation in production environments unless specifically asked to do otherwise.
5. How much does it cost to hire a virtual assailant?
Expense varies based upon the scope, the size of the network, and the depth of the test. A standard web application penetration test might cost between ₤ 5,000 and ₤ 20,000, while a full-blown Red Team engagement for a large business can go beyond ₤ 100,000.
